The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ies with an option to work from home (WFH) and a requirement for T-SQL sk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ited T-SQL over the 6 months to 14 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
14 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 181 239 174
Rank change year-on-year +58 -65 -25
Permanent jobs citing T-SQL 607 591 1,612
As % of all permanent jobs with a WFH option 1.80% 1.44% 2.31%
As % of the Programming Languages category 4.41% 2.94% 3.91%
Number of salaries quoted 510 545 1,212
10th Percentile £39,750 £40,000 £35,000
25th Percentile £47,500 £47,500 £42,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,500 £55,000 £52,500
Median % change year-on-year +4.55% +4.76% +5.00%
75th Percentile £63,750 £67,500 £63,750
90th Percentile £72,500 £77,500 £75,000
UK median annual salary £55,000 £57,500 £55,000
% change year-on-year -4.35% +4.55% +10.00%
